Conclusion
Shimano Beastmaster 12000 MD edges out Daiwa BG MQ 3000D-XHX with slightly better overall performance, especially on the durability (9.5 out of 10) and the maximum drag (43kg / 94,8lbs). Still, Daiwa BG MQ 3000D-XHX holds its own with strengths like a weight of 265g / 9,35oz and a line retrieve per crank of 83 centimeter / 32.68 inch, making it a solid choice depending on your preferences and fishing needs.
